Fenway solutions ensure the performance, availability, scalability and transaction integrity of application infrastructures built around an application server. IT managers require a comprehensive management solution such as Fenway, with the ability to monitor every detail within that infrastructure. This includes monitoring multiple applications, servers, databases, application server components and any performance-related events that lead up to a transaction failure. In sync with BEA's adoption of the JMX standard, customer developed Java applications that have been JMX-enabled, can be managed by Fenway further enabling organizations to extract business logic to help improve eBusiness profitability.
